Hotel in Lufkin with fitness center and business center This smoke-free hotel features a restaurant, a fitness center, and a bar/lounge. Free WiFi in public areas and free self parking are also provided. Other amenities include a snack bar/deli, a coffee shop/cafe, and a business center. Change of towels is available on request. Courtyard Lufkin offers 101 air-conditioned accommodations with hair dryers and irons/ironing boards. Accommodations are furnished with desks and desk chairs. This Lufkin hotel provides complimentary wired and wireless Internet access. Business-friendly amenities include phones along with free local calls (restrictions may apply). Recreational amenities at the hotel include a fitness center.
